Dear Preschool Families, It looks like we are getting into the rhythm! Children are familiar with routines and know what to expect each day. During morning drop-off times, please remember we encourage all families from Crickets to Coyotes, please tell your child goodbye and inform them of your departure. Leaving without notice can cause your child to feel abandonment, and it is terrifying for them to see you there one minute while gone the next. Please be careful during pick up. There is a lot of traffic, and it is easy for children to fall behind or run ahead of you. If you see any unsafe activity, please report to Mrs. Chavez-Rodriguez.
